Explore BasketWhy You’ll Want to Watch This Stock
Aftermarket Revenue Strength
Consumables and service contracts create steady recurring income that can stabilise revenue, though instrument orders remain cyclical and can vary.
Pharma & Regulation Demand
Demand from drug development and regulatory testing supports long-term need for high-end instruments, but exposure to regulatory cycles and geographic shifts adds variability.
Innovation & Competition
Continued R&D keeps the product line competitive in high-precision analytics, yet heavy R&D spend and rival technologies present execution risks.
